Starcraft II Fansite Kit Updated with 7 New Screenshots
Many of the newest art updates have actually been made in the animations, weapon particles, and in special effects, which are much harder to show in screenshots. For instance, Hellions now burn Marines to a crisp when they are destroyed by the flames. Dark Templars also end up eviscerating Marauders in a ruthless fashion. Win Starcraft II Beta Keys in Vespene Laughs! Contest
Yesterday Karune posted an update to the Vespene Laughs! contest, the first place winner will now receive two Starcraft II beta keys. In the Vespene Laughs! contest fans submit their funniest Starcraft related comics to Blizzard for a chance to win the following prizes below, a winner will be chosen each month.

Battle of the Dark Templars: Who will you choose?
Blizzard is allowing the Starcraft community to take part in choosing which Dark Templar will appear in multiplayer. Below are your three options, visit the Dark Templar page to cast your vote.
